Transaction 5dafe639ed0e768c287c3934f98e2800403981b74ad6072defe8aab798c0e709

1 Input
2 Outputs
  • 5dafe639ed0e768c287c3934f98e2800403981b74ad6072defe8aab798c0e709:0
  • value  136600
    address  18XkhSeuSyiEztXDpv9LcNMPUmKKnpBhVZ
  • 5dafe639ed0e768c287c3934f98e2800403981b74ad6072defe8aab798c0e709:1
  • value  22501527
    address  3MbjoJzB1pohm7ZePUTA3JwQhhdGXg1pbQ